Get all the practice you need to pass the NCLEX-RN examination with Saunders Q&A for the NCLEX-RN® Examination, 4th Edition! Over 5,200 NCLEX-RN examination-style questions each with rationales, test-taking strategies, and textbook page references for each question provide immediate feedback and make it easy to learn and understand the material. Plus, you can study on the computer in three different modes - study, quiz, or exam - with the companion CD.
- UNIQUE! Page references to Mosby or Saunders textbooks direct you to additional material for any question answered incorrectly.
- Questions categorized by cognitive level, client needs area, integrated process, and clinical content area help you focus on the question types you find most difficult.
- UNIQUE! Chapters organized by Client Needs familiarize you with the question mix in the NCLEX test plan blueprint.
- All alternate item format-questions (multiple response, prioritizing, fill-in-the-blank, figure/illustration, and chart/exhibit) are included.
- Introductory chapters on nonacademic preparation, test-taking tips, the unique CAT format, and more provide a solid foundation for your NCLEX-RN examination review.
- An additional 200 questions provide even more opportunity for practice.
- UNIQUE! Questions on heart and lung sounds with audio on the Companion CD provide practice with this new alternate item format expected to appear on future NCLEX-RN examinations.
- Content from the new April 2007 NCLEX-RN test plan familiarizes you with the newest topics you could see on the exam.

Great questions and explanations to prepare for NCLEX-RN
I bought several books to prepare for NCLEX, but I liked this book the best. I used other books and my notes from school to review contents, and used this book to practice questions. It does not cover each system one by one like nursing textbooks, but rather the chapters are organized in the NCLEX way (e.g. client needs, safe and effective care environment, health promotion, psychosocial integrity, etc.). I did not use CD as much as I planned at the time of purchase because the characters were small and made my eyes tired. (The characters on real NCLEX were bigger and clearer on the screen than this software.) I did not have any problem with this CD like the other reviewers. The book alone has 1810Qs, and they were more than enough for me. Although this book is thick (about 1 1/2 inches) and heavy, I liked the fact that I could take it to anywhere to study. I recognized several NCLEX questions similar to what I practiced in this book, and I passed in 75Qs!
